Hey there – hope you're hungry
So you found this blog however you found it – Facebook, Twitter, Pinterest, etc. – and you're probably wondering a little bit about the writer, who likes to write using the "we" form, but is in fact one individual. After so many wordy posts and drawn-out descriptions, it's likely you're craving some hard facts. Here you go.
1. My given name is Margaret, but no one calls me that. It's Maggie to most. Weirdest misspelling of my name? Bargaret. Yep.
2. I live in Colorado but was raised in the South.
3. I've got a thing for mountains, mountain towns and mountain folk.
4. Bananas, store-bought mayonnaise and pickles (or relish) are about the only things I won't eat.
5. Carnitas, frozen yogurt, peanut butter and oatmeal are things I would eat every day.
6. Sea urchin was the oddest food I've ever eaten.
7. Haggis is the oddest food I've never eaten that I'd like to.
8. During the day, I'm a marketing lady/food writer/doer-of-anything-that-needs-doing at a Denver newspaper.
9. My husband is a preschool teacher/upright bassist.
10. We play in a band together, and yes it's totally cute that we can share passions.
11. I love and hate running equally, but most days I love it a little more than I hate it.
